What is the formula for ionic compound formed between chloride and al3?

The formula for the ionic compound formed between chloride and Al3+ would be AlCl3 (aluminum chloride). Aluminum has a 3+ charge, and chloride has a 1- charge, so it takes three chloride ions to balance the charge of one aluminum ion in the compound.

What is the correct formula for the combination of an aluminum ion and a chloride ion that form the ionic compound aluminum chloride?

The correct formula for aluminum chloride is AlCl3. This is because aluminum typically forms a 3+ ion (Al3+) and chloride forms a 1- ion (Cl-), so three chloride ions are needed to balance the charge of one aluminum ion in the compound.
